NeoGAF user uncovers listing for special Gold and Silver Mario Amiibo

Wave 2 of rare silver and gold versions of Nintendo’s Amiibo

Just like a mythical unicorn sighting, it seems that some users have caught a glimpse of rare silver and gold versions of the Mario Amiibo. User KT$2448 has posted two images of what appears to be listings for special silver and gold versions of the Mario Amiibo from the Mario Party 10 collection. These listings have since been taken down. The images do look authentic enough but with no official information from Nintendo to back it up, it should be treated as just a rumour for now.

There is a chance that these special silver and gold Mario Amiibos are a mixed in with the Mario Party 10 shipment, or that they could be part of the Club Nintendo rewards. With Club Nintendo shutting down later this year, it is possible that these special Amiibos are included in the prizes that will be handed out to Gold and Platinum club members. This would be a great way for Nintendo to thank its fans for their loyalty over the years.

If these rumours turn out to be true, than the gold and silver versions are likely to become a rare collector ’s item.
